Protecting Your Docks and Boosting Airtightness with Dock Shelters
Dock shelters are essential elements for any warehouse or distribution center that depends loading docks. These versatile structures not only defend your valuable goods from the harshness of outdoor elements but also greatly improve airtightness, leading to operational efficiency and financial savings. By creating a impermeable barrier between your loading bay and the outside world, dock shelters limit drafts, temperature fluctuations, and the entry of dust, debris, and pollutants. This leads in a more consistent indoor environment, which is crucial for maintaining product quality, worker safety, and overall operational efficiency.
Improving Energy Efficiency and Stopping Weather Entry with Dock Seals
Dock seals are essential components for any warehouse or distribution center that aims to enhance its energy savings. These flexible barriers effectively separate the gap between loading docks and delivery vehicles, preventing the escape of conditioned air during loading and unloading activities. By cutting drafts and temperature fluctuations, dock seals play a role to a more energy-responsible facility. Furthermore, they offer barrier against unwanted elements, securing valuable inventory and equipment from the harshness of rain, snow, wind, and sunlight.

Opting for the Right Dock Equipment: A Guide to Dock Levelers, Shelters & Seals
When it comes to maximizing effectiveness in your loading and unloading operations, choosing the right dock equipment is crucial. A well-equipped dock can streamline workflows, improve safety, and ultimately reduce costs. This guide will walk you through the essential components: dock levelers, shelters, and seals, helping you grasp their functions and select the best options for your specific needs.
- Dock Levelers: These versatile devices bridge the gap between loading docks and trailers, providing a safe and level platform for efficient cargo transfer.
- Shelters: Protecting goods from environmental factors is paramount. Shelters create a barrier against rain, snow, wind, and sun, ensuring your inventory remains in top condition.
- Seals: Preventing air leakage between the dock and trailer is key for temperature control and minimizing energy costs. Seals guarantee a tight fit, keeping your cargo secure and comfortable.
By carefully considering your requirements, you can outfit your dock with the perfect combination of levelers, shelters, and seals, optimizing both your operations and your bottom line.
